Fish collecting device suitable for collecting fishes by deep open sea net cage Technical Field The utility model relates to the technical field of fish collection of culture net cages, in particular to a fish collection device suitable for collecting fish in deep open sea net cages. Background The deep sea aquaculture technology is a novel aquaculture mode, and provides a more superior growth environment for cultured organisms by placing the aquaculture net cage in a deep sea area and utilizing relatively stable water quality and rich biological resources in the deep sea. The technology not only improves the yield and quality of cultivation, but also reduces the ecological environment pressure on the offshore area. Deep sea aquaculture net cages are usually placed in the sea area far away from the shore and large in water depth, traditional manual fish collecting modes require divers to submerge deep sea manual operation, efficiency is relatively low, the process is greatly influenced by natural factors such as weather, sea conditions and the like, the fishing progress can be slow, and the submarine ecological environment can be damaged by traditional fishing modes. Disclosure of utility model The utility model aims to solve the defects in the prior art, and provides the fish collecting device suitable for collecting fishes in the deep open sea net cage, which reduces the risk and labor intensity of manual fishing by using a winch for fishing, can quickly catch the cultivated organisms from the deep sea, and greatly improves the fishing efficiency. The fish collecting device comprises a fish collecting net, winches, guide wheels, first cables and second cables, wherein the winches are arranged at the top of the deep-sea net, the guide wheels are arranged at the bottom of the deep-sea net, each winch is correspondingly arranged above one guide wheel, the first cables and the second cables are wound around each winch in a reverse winding mode, four corners of the fish collecting net are connected with the first cables on each winch respectively, and the second cables on each winch penetrate through the corresponding guide wheels below the winch and are connected with four corners of the fish collecting net respectively. Example 1 Referring to fig. 1 to 2, the fish collecting device suitable for collecting fish in a deep-open sea cage provided by the embodiment is arranged at the deep-open sea cage, the deep-open sea cage comprises a cage frame and a netting, the cage frame is a cuboid cage frame, and the netting is respectively arranged o
